Jenna can paint the shed in 2 hours. Juan can paint it in 1.5 hours. • Jenna says is they work together the job will take 1/2+1/
Harlamova29_29 [7]

Answer:

There is a formula for this:

[Worker 1 Time * Worker 2 Time] / [Worker 1 Time + Worker 2 Time]

[2 * 1.5] / [2 + 1.5] = 3.0 / 3.5

= 0.8571428571 Hours =

51.43 minutes

Both Jenna and Juan are INCORRECT.
